E rik Selin is a Swedish self-made real estate billionaire and the founder and CEO of Fastighets AB Balder, one of the largest property companies in the Nordic region. He began his investment career at a young age, buying his first apartment building when he was in his early 20s. He has since built a massive real estate empire from the ground up.
He founded Balder and has grown it through a relentless strategy of acquiring residential and commercial properties across Sweden and in other Nordic countries. He is known for his sharp deal-making skills and his deep understanding of the property market. In addition to his primary real estate holdings in Balder, he is also a major shareholder in a number of other companies, particularly in the financial sector, including a significant stake in the Swedish collector and credit management company, Collector Bank.

Erik Selin is a Swedish businessman, the self-made billionaire CEO and controlling owner of Fastighets AB Balder (STO: BALD B), one of the largest and most prominent property developers in Sweden and the Nordic region. Born in 1967, his career is rooted in real estate investment and development.
Selin's strategic vision was audacious: focus on acquiring, developing, and managing a massive, diversified portfolio spanning residential, commercial, and urban properties across Scandinavia and Northern Europe. His philosophical approach emphasizes local management, customer satisfaction, and long-term asset hold, a commitment that defined his massive empire.
Erik Selin founded Fastighets AB Balder in 1999 (operational since 2005). His growth strategy focused on aggressive expansion across Sweden, Denmark, Finland, Norway, Germany, and the U.K. Balder's portfolio grew to include both residential properties and key commercial/urban projects, including major stakes in the development of the Karlatornet (a landmark skyscraper in Gothenburg).
Under his leadership as CEO and controlling owner, Balder became one of Sweden's largest hotel owners (owning 50 hotels) and achieved a market valuation in the billions of euros. Selin maintains a vast network of investments beyond property, serving as Chairman of Norion Bank (formerly Collector AB) and SATO Oyj. His wealth is secured by the colossal, appreciating value of the highly diversified real estate portfolio he controls.

Erik Selin's social impact is structural, stemming from Balder's role in providing essential residential and commercial infrastructure across Sweden and the Nordic region. The company provides housing and commercial space for thousands of tenants and businesses.
His personal philanthropy supports various educational, cultural, and community initiatives, including major funding for the Gothenburg School of Business, Economics and Law (his alma mater). His commitment to sustainability is a core focus of Balder's development and management strategy.
